Django 在iframe裡跳轉頂層url的例子

2022-09-26 19:00:27 字數 746 閱讀 3377

描述

a網頁為乙個專門設程式設計客棧計的登入頁面login.html,通過iframe巢狀在b頁面中index.html,登入後會進入後台c頁面consule.html.問題來了,登入成功後,通過django-url跳轉,頁面一直在iframe裡面,沒有跳出嵌入的框架中。

解決方法

通過httpresponse來返回一段js指令碼,直接讓你丫的跳,**如下

def login(request):

login_form = loginform()

if request.method == 'post':

login_form = loginform(request.post)

if login_form.is_valid():

username = login_form.data['username']

#通過js來跳轉頁面,取巧

本文標題: django 在iframe裡跳轉頂層url的例子

本文位址:

在django裡寫自己的api

從特定 獲取json資料 將json資料序列化字典格式 將字典格式資料反序列化json資料傳遞給模板 工具 rest frawork from website.models import video 獲取json資料的model from rest framework import serializ...

在django中實現頁面倒數幾秒後自動跳轉的例子

實現倒計時跳轉要和html中的js結合起來,例如 實現乙個頁面簡單的註冊,然後註冊成功後倒計時自動跳轉到登入頁面。註冊頁面 def regiswww.cppcns.comter request return render request,register.html 點選註冊 def doregist...

操作跨域iframe 裡div

iframe裡的元素無法用css來直接控制,不管是同域還是跨域。可選方法 父window接收資料 window.addeventlistener message function event 父元素向子元素傳送資料 iframe.contentwindow.postmessage data,第二個引...